shell/python code
The situation regarding logging is different when a function called by
bb.build.exec_func() fails compared to when the task code fails
directly. There is a recent fix in bitbake to solve that and these
tests will hopefully prevent regressions.

We've seen issues where shell/python tasks lose their log file entries
or output and also where output is duplicated. Add some tests to attempt
to spot regressions in this area in future.
